Transaction 252123893b85aa5726e2fc893605b5b9879f462074f82eea01e1406979011415
1 Input
1 Output
-
252123893b85aa5726e2fc893605b5b9879f462074f82eea01e1406979011415:0
- value
- 8831296
- script pubkey
- OP_0 OP_PUSHBYTES_20 f38db18e053522407b3b011ebeb9efc14bbb0655
- address
- bc1q7wxmrrs9x53yq7emqy0taw00c99mkpj4s0th9k